This exquisite 0.50ct onyx and 0.20ct diamond Art Deco pendant, crafted in platinum around 1930, is a striking example of the glamour and precision of the era. The lozenge-shaped design features a beautifully scalloped onyx panel, enhanced by a delicate millegrain foliate motif at its centre. A vertical arrangement of old European and Dutch cut diamonds, including a sparkling circular halo, adds brilliance and contrast, while the finely pierced geometric frame showcases the clean lines and symmetry that define Art Deco style. The pendant is completed with a tapering bale set with an additional Dutch cut diamond, creating a graceful drop that catches the light with every movement.
